From increasing phone addiction to hampering mental performance, here are some harmful effects of using the phone as soon as you wake up in the morning.
Most of us have a habit of checking our phones as soon as we wake up. This is also because many of us set a morning alarm on our phones – when we wake up, in the process of turning off the alarm, we get caught in a cycle of checking our texts, notifications, and our social media profiles. This can have a huge impact on our health. Mindless scrolling in the morning affects our performance throughout the day and also takes away our morning hours, which could be used in a healthier way.
Here are some harmful effects of using the phone in the morning that we should know about:

Harmful effects on mental health:
When we mindlessly check our emails, social media and text messages in the morning, this can lead to stress, anxiety and symptoms of depression. Watching the news as soon as you wake up in the morning can also lead to symptoms of depression.
Harms our mental performance:
Morning time should be used to increase physical, mental and emotional strength. However, when we spend hours replying to messages and mails, we end up receiving a lot of useless information in the process which can disrupt our planning for the rest of the day.

It forces us to respond, not react:
When we wake up in the morning and check our work texts and emails, we get into reactive mode. This can leave us feeling exhausted all day. We fail to respond in a healthy way, and instead react to everything.
Makes addiction worse:
Screen addiction is real, and when we get into the habit of checking our phones as soon as we wake up in the morning, it fuels our phone addiction and makes it worse. When we subconsciously reach for our phones right after waking up, we give it control and fall into its trap.

Tips for breaking the pattern:
We should create a mindful environment where we get enough time in the morning to enhance physical and mental well-being. From practicing yoga or meditation to journaling or going for a morning walk, we can take our focus off the screen and enhance our well-being.
